Phreesia's Positive Earnings Spark Optimism Among Analysts

Phreesia Surprises with Strong Q2 Earnings
Phreesia, Inc. (NYSE: PHR) has recently reported its second-quarter earnings, which threw a spotlight on the company's robust performance. The earnings revealed a surprising profit of 1 cent per share, in stark contrast to the anticipated loss of 6 cents. Additionally, the company's sales figures of $117.255 million slightly exceeded market expectations of $116.526 million, making it a noteworthy achievement in the current financial landscape.
Exceeding Sales Guidance
Phreesia has maintained its fiscal year 2026 sales guidance in the range of $472 million to $482 million, which is encouraging given that the market had anticipated around $477.148 million. Strategic Acquisition Plans
Moreover, Indig announced a significant acquisition, revealing a definitive agreement to acquire AccessOne—a well-regarded leader in financing solutions for healthcare receivables. This strategic acquisition is expected to bolster Phreesia's offerings and potentially unlock new revenue streams, reinforcing the company's commitment to enhancing patient care.
Market Reaction
Despite the positive earnings report, Phreesia shares experienced a decline of 8.5%, trading at $28.59 shortly after the announcement. This dip is viewed by some analysts as a normal reaction in a volatile market as investors digest the latest information.
Analysts' Outlook on Phreesia Stock
Following the earnings announcement, several analysts have adjusted their expectations for Phreesia. For instance, Ryan MacDonald from Needham continues to support the stock with a Buy rating, increasing the price target from $29 to $35. Meanwhile, Jessica Tassan from Piper Sandler also maintained a favorable outlook with an Overweight rating and slightly increased her price target from $33 to $34. Similarly, Richard Close of Canaccord Genuity reaffirmed a Buy rating and revised the price target upwards from $34 to $38.
